How do you bake a cake in a microwave without convection?

You can bake a cake in a standard (non-convection) microwave using the regular microwave mode, but the result will have a different texture, more like a steamed pudding, and will not brown on top. This method is very quick, typically taking only a few minutes.

How do you make a simple cake in the microwave?

Instructions

  1. Add flour, sugar, baking powder, and salt to a mug and stir together.
  2. Stir in milk, melted butter, and vanilla extract until smooth, being sure to scrape the bottom of the mug. Stir in sprinkles.
  3. Cook in microwave for 70-90 seconds* (until cake is just set, but still barely shiny on top).

Can I bake cake mix in the microwave?

Get an angel food cake mix box for every other boxed flavor you have. Then mix them together 1 to 1, angel food cake mix and other cake mix. Then, whenever you want cake take 3 TBSP of your now mixed dry cake flavors, and stir in 2 TBSP water in a mug. Pop in a microwave for 60-90 seconds and voila, mug cake.

Is it better to bake a cake with or without convection?

Regular bake is preferred for cakes, breads and other delicate desserts due to the slower baking process. If you're looking for crispy and browned results, you may want to choose convection baking.

What is the difference between a convection microwave and a non convection microwave?

The main difference between conventional and convection microwaves is their heating elements. Traditional microwaves cook food using electromagnetic waves, while convection microwaves have an additional heating element and fan to circulate heat throughout the cavity.

How do I stop my cake from being rubbery?

Rubbery cake usually is the by-product of one or more of these causes:

  1. You've over-mixed the batter. The eggs in a cake are precious and will stiffen the longer you mix. ...
  2. You… may have forgotten an ingredient. ...
  3. Expired leavenings. Your baking powder and baking soda do have a shelf life and will lose potency.

How do you make a quick easy cake in the microwave?

Mix flour, sugar, cocoa powder, baking soda, and salt together in a large microwave-safe mug; stir in milk, canola oil, water, and vanilla extract. Cook in the microwave until cake is done in the middle, about 1 minute 45 seconds. Enjoy!

What temperature for cake baking?

The standard temperature range for baking most cakes is between 325°F and 350°F (160°C and 180°C). This range works well for many classic cakes, including sponge and pound cakes. For example, a traditional vegan chocolate cake typically bakes at 350°F, ensuring a moist and rich texture without overcooking.

How to bake cake in microwave without convection mode?

Set the Microwave Power Level: Unlike convection microwaves, non-convection microwaves don't require preheating. Set the microwave to medium or high power (depending on your microwave's wattage) to get the best results. Baking Time: Place the dish in the microwave and set the timer for around 5 to 7 minutes.

How long can I bake in the microwave without convection?

Baking in Microwave without Convection – Quick Steps Guide

Pour the batter in the mould. Place it in the microwave. Do not open the microwave door during baking. Bake for 5 Minutes, 30 Seconds (in case of 600 Watts) & 4 Minutes (In case of 900 Watts).
